Smart Auto-Torch Mod is for every player who’s sick of running caves like a human torch dispenser. Instead of spamming right-click every few blocks, this addon watches the light level around you and, when it gets properly sketchy, it places a torch behind you automatically. You just walk, mine, fight, loot—by the time you turn around, your path is cleanly lit and you didn’t have to think about it once.
The smart part is that it doesn’t waste your resources. Before dropping a torch, the addon checks a small radius around you for real light sources—lava pools, lanterns, glowstone, whatever you already placed. If the area is bright enough, it does nothing and lets you keep your torches. That means no random torches under glowstone veins, no double-lighting mineshafts, and no weird spam all over finished builds. It even tells caves apart from shady tree spots, so walking under a giant oak at noon doesn’t suddenly start burning through your stack.
Where it really shines is long mining sessions and hardcore cave dives. You can sprint down fresh tunnels with your pick swinging, and Smart Auto-Torch quietly locks in a safe return path behind you. When you’re chasing ores, dodging skeletons, or running low on food, not having to think about lighting is huge. And if you’re building a spooky base or doing redstone work where you actually want the dark, there’s a built-in kill switch: just rename a stick to “Torch Off,” hold it in your main hand, and the addon instantly shuts up until you’re ready to flip it back on.

Installation Mod:
- Download the .mcaddon / .mcpack;
- Open the file to import into the game;
- In World Settings → Resource Packs and Behavior Packs, enable it (turn on Experiments if needed);
